West Chester Baseball Sweeps East Stroudsburg At Home

Box Score 1 | Box Score 2

WEST CHESTER, Pa. – West Chester University's baseball team pulled out a doubleheader sweep against PSAC East rival East Stroudsburg by scores of 4-3 and 10-5 on a 75-degree Saturday afternoon at Serpico Stadium.

The Golden Rams (20-8, 15-5 PSAC East) reached their 20th win of the season to remain in second place behind Millersville University in the league standings. They would put it all together with a walk-off RBI-double in their half the seventh in game one. West Chester created a seven-run lead in game two and never looked back.

East Stroudsburg (22-13, 10-12) came all the way back from three-runs down to tie it in the top of the seventh inning of game one. But, Robert Knox, who led off the bottom of the seventh with a walk, scored all the way from first base on a double by Bill Ford to hand over the win. The Golden Rams posted an 8-1 lead, taking advantage of four errors in the nightcap. ESU made things interesting, loading the bases in the seventh and scoring two runs to cut the lead in half. However, those would be the only runs in the inning as back-to-back hitters popped up to first base and second base to conclude the sweep for West Chester.

Left-handed pitcher, Nick Stallings remained perfect on the season at 6-0, allowing three runs in 4 1/3 innings with seven walks and two strikeouts in game two. Sophomore righty, Andrew Gernert improved to 3-2 after pitching a complete game, allowing only three runs on eight hits, three walks, while striking out five in the opener.

Third baseman, Anthony Salomone had four RBIs and scored one run off a 4-for-8 day at the plate. Bill Ford hit the game-winning double in game one and provided another run in game two for a .500 batting average on the afternoon.

Justin Roman scored three runs and knocked in another while Dylan Tice went 2-for-5 with a RBI, run scored and three walks. Matt Pertrizzi hit a two-run triple in game one and a sacrifice fly to give the Golden Rams the lead in the first game.

West Chester hits the road to play East Stroudsburg at their place to conclude the series tomorrow at 1 p.m.
